Key fob replacement
Subaru owners often depend on the key fob for locking and unlocking their doors, opening their vehicles and controlling various features. It is important to always have a spare Subaru fob as you never know when it may be lost. Our service department in Santa Clara can replace a Subaru key fob battery fast.
The first step is opening the casing of the fob's exterior. This can be accomplished by pressing the metal emergency key or by using the flathead screwdriver. The next step is to locate the flat, round battery and release it. Install a new battery in it, and put the fob together.

Ignition switch/lock cylinder replacement
If you're not able to turn the ignition switch or your Subaru key fob isn't working, you may need an entirely new ignition. It can be expensive and will require a trip to a dealer or locksmith.
However, if you haven't had any issues with your key battery, or if you're vehicle's power locks are working in a way, the problem could be a different issue. If the key is turning further than it used to, you may require a new ignition coil.
The majority of modern subaru key replacement keys have an immobilizer that stops your car from starting with a stolen key, or with a key that isn't programmed to the vehicle. The immobilizer, a microchip that is located on the key, transmits a signal that the key is valid to the vehicle. This helps prevent theft and other issues. If you need to replace a Subaru key with an immobilizer, our #StockerSubaru dealership suggests getting a standard key that does not have the transmitter.
In the past, you could have your traditional metal keys copied at the local hardware store or a locksmith. However, modern Subaru vehicles have a sophisticated computer that controls the key and engine. Therefore, you should work with a certified technician who has the tools and software to complete the task. Additionally, you'll require the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N), registration papers, your ID, and proof of insurance to obtain the replacement key.
